Efficiency Ratings Matter

Efficiency ratings play an important role in the selection of solar panels, influencing both energy production and cost-effectiveness. Greater efficiency ratings show that a panel can convert a higher percentage of sunlight into usable electricity, which is crucial for maximizing energy output, especially in restricted space. Usually, panels range from 15% to over 22% efficiency, with premium models providing superior performance. When picking solar panels, it is essential to examine their efficiency in relation to the available installation area and overall energy requirements. Additionally, high-efficiency panels may have a higher upfront cost but can lead to substantial long-term savings through reduced energy bills. As a result, comprehending efficiency ratings is critical to making an informed investment in solar technology.

Warranty and Durability

Warranty and durability are essential factors in picking solar panels, as they directly affect the long-term performance and reliability of the system. A robust warranty typically extends from 10 to 25 years, covering both product defects and performance degradation. Consumers should examine the manufacturer's reputation and the particulars of the warranty, including what is covered and the method for claims. Durability is determined by the materials used; panels should be resilient to environmental stressors such as hail, wind, and corrosion. Certifications, like those from the International Electrotechnical Commission (IEC), can provide verification of a panel's robustness. In the end, a well-warranted and durable solar panel ensures peace of mind and optimizes the investment in renewable energy.

Care Guidelines for Long-Life Solar Systems

Ongoing maintenance is important for maintaining the longevity and best performance of solar systems. Homeowners should frequently inspect their solar panels for accumulated dirt, debris, and obstructions that may reduce efficiency. Cleaning the panels a few times a year can dramatically enhance energy production. Additionally, checking for any signs of wear or damage, such as cracks or loose connections, is important, as these issues can affect overall functionality.

It is also advisable to keep an eye on the inverter's functionality and ensure that it is performing optimally, as this component is crucial for energy conversion. Organizing professional inspections each year can help detect potential issues early. Furthermore, trimming adjacent trees or vegetation that may cast shadows on the panels will optimize sunlight exposure. By applying these straightforward maintenance tips, solar system owners can benefit from optimal energy generation and increase the lifespan of their investment.

What Should You Expect Throughout the Installation Process?

Homeowners who have debunked common myths surrounding solar panel installation can better appreciate the process involved in setting up a solar energy system. The setup process generally starts with a property evaluation, during which professionals assess roofing status, sunlight availability, and power requirements. Subsequently, a personalized blueprint is created, specifying panel arrangement and system details.

After the design receives approval, the installation team arranges the work, which typically takes from one to three days. During installation, mounting hardware is attached to the roof, and solar panels are firmly mounted. Electrical connections are completed, joining the panels to the inverter and the home's power system.

Following installation, a final inspection confirms all components are functioning correctly and satisfy safety standards. Homeowners can look forward to being connected to the grid soon after, enabling them to start experiencing the benefits of their new solar energy system, including lower energy bills and reduced carbon footprint.

What Happens During a Power Outage With Solar Panels?

Throughout a power outage, solar panels usually do not supply electricity unless outfitted with a battery storage system or a special inverter. This safety measure avoids backfeeding electricity into the grid, safeguarding utility workers.

How Long Can Solar Panels Be Expected to Last?

Solar panel systems generally last between 25 to 30 years. Their performance may gradually decrease over time, but most manufacturers supply warranties that guarantee efficiency and power production for at least 25 years, guaranteeing long-term reliability.
